No Health-Based Violations

None of the 8 water systems serving this ZIP have exceeded federal contaminant limits in the past 5 years. There is1 monitoring/reporting violation (missed testing deadlines), all resolved.

Better than 29% of US ZIP codes.

Based on EPA compliance data. Not a substitute for an official water quality report from your utility.

Contaminants Found

NitrateMonitoring

At high levels, nitrate can cause blue baby syndrome in infants.

1 violation
All resolved
